2021 1/4 oz Gold Australian Spotted Eagle Ray Coin BU
Bullion Exchanges is excited to present the 2021 1/4 oz Gold Australian Spotted Eagle Ray Coin BU, a stunning release from the Perth Mint. This coin is meticulously crafted from 0.9999 pure gold and weighs 1/4 troy oz, offered in Brilliant Uncirculated Condition. A striking tribute to one of Australia's most intriguing marine species, this gold coin combines both the allure of precious metals with the captivating beauty of the underwater world, making it a perfect choice for collectors and investors alike.
The Perth Mint, renowned for its exceptional craftsmanship and innovative coin designs, is one of the leading mints globally. Established in 1899 as part of the British Royal Mint system, the Perth Mint has a long-standing reputation for producing high-quality precious metal products that are both investment-worthy and collectible. This commitment to excellence is evident in every coin they produce, including the 2021 Gold Australian Spotted Eagle Ray, which features intricate detailing and artistic precision.
Coin Specifications:
- Contains 1/4 troy oz of .9999 fine gold
- Brilliant Uncirculated Condition
- Produced by the Perth Mint
- Face Value of $25 (AUD), backed by the Australian government
- Obverse: Features Queen Elizabeth II with inscriptions for denomination, weight, purity, and year.
- Reverse: Depicts an Australian spotted eagle ray with the Perth Mint's "P" mint mark.
